index
:
fastd
master
Fast and Secure Tunnelling Daemon
Matthias Schiffer <mschiffer@universe-factory.net>
summary
refs
log
tree
commit
diff
stats
log msg
author
committer
range
Age
Commit message (
Expand
)
Author
2013-11-16
ghash: builtin: use bytewise lookup table
Matthias Schiffer
2013-11-16
Add "tiny" copy of the builtin ghash implementation
Matthias Schiffer
2013-11-16
fastd_buffer_alloc: fix output of error message if posix_memalign fails
Matthias Schiffer
2013-11-16
aes128-ctr: allocate only one piece of memory for the key state
Matthias Schiffer
2013-11-16
generic-gcm: fix a GCC uninitialized-use warning
Matthias Schiffer
2013-11-16
blowfish-ctr: some optimizations to the builtin implementation
Matthias Schiffer
2013-11-15
Allow using blowfish from OpenSSL on systems where it's available anyways
Matthias Schiffer
2013-11-15
config: move check for no configured method
Matthias Schiffer
2013-11-15
methods/common: decrease nonce length to 6, add flags byte
Matthias Schiffer
2013-11-14
Ensure sessions are invalidated before the nonce wraps
Matthias Schiffer
2013-11-14
Move test for initiator in the session refresh check from protocol to method
Matthias Schiffer
2013-11-07
CMake: add LINK_LIBRARIES workaround for old CMake versions
Matthias Schiffer
2013-11-07
CMake: really avoid target_include_directories
Matthias Schiffer
2013-11-07
CMake: avoid target_include_directories command to stay compatible with CMake...
Matthias Schiffer
2013-11-06
blowfish-ctr: use the whole 56-byte key
Matthias Schiffer
2013-11-05
Generalize cipher/MAC key/IV lengths
Matthias Schiffer
2013-11-04
Add simple blowfish-ctr cipher implementation
Matthias Schiffer
2013-11-03
Include protocol as a static library as well
Matthias Schiffer
2013-11-03
Allow building without NaCl again
Matthias Schiffer
2013-11-03
Fix disabling modules
Matthias Schiffer
2013-11-03
Improve build system for ciphers and MACs as well
Matthias Schiffer
2013-11-03
Even nicer method specification
Matthias Schiffer
2013-11-02
Make adding new methods a bit nicer
Matthias Schiffer
2013-11-02
More CMake cleanup and fixes
Matthias Schiffer
2013-11-02
Separate cmake files
Matthias Schiffer
2013-11-02
Move a few prototypes from fastd.h into a new config.h
Matthias Schiffer
2013-11-02
Move all generated headers to the src subdir
Matthias Schiffer
2013-11-02
Change error message for methods from `invalid' to `unsupported'
Matthias Schiffer
2013-11-02
Remove old defines from fastd_config.h
Matthias Schiffer
2013-11-02
Algorithms without implementation aren't available
Matthias Schiffer
2013-11-02
Convert ghash to the new crypto algorithm scheme
Matthias Schiffer
2013-11-02
Convert aes128-gcm into a generic gcm method
Matthias Schiffer
2013-11-02
Allow flexible specification of methods provided by an implementation
Matthias Schiffer
2013-11-02
Correctly handle ciphers without implementation
Matthias Schiffer
2013-11-02
Implement the first step towards a more flexible way to support crypto methods
Matthias Schiffer
2013-11-01
The attribute is called aligned, not align
Matthias Schiffer
2013-11-01
Use HKDF for handshake keys as well
Matthias Schiffer
2013-11-01
Use HKDF to derive the session keys
Matthias Schiffer
2013-11-01
Add missing const attribute to secret argument of the session init functions
Matthias Schiffer
2013-11-01
Implement new session init API
Matthias Schiffer
2013-10-31
Implement HKDF
Matthias Schiffer
2013-10-31
ec25519-fhmqvc: generate compat keys only when needed
Matthias Schiffer
2013-10-31
ec25519-fhmqvc: don't use separate keypairs as initiator and responder
Matthias Schiffer
2013-10-31
Revert "ec25519-fhmqvc: make the new shared handshake key two hashes long (on...
Matthias Schiffer
2013-10-31
ec25519-fhmqvc: make the new shared handshake key two hashes long (only the f...
Matthias Schiffer
2013-10-31
ec25519-fhmqvc: add a new shared handshake key field (which is equivalent to ...
Matthias Schiffer
2013-10-31
More compat renaming
Matthias Schiffer
2013-10-31
ec25519-fhmqvc: some more refactoring
Matthias Schiffer
2013-10-31
ec25519-fhmqvc: some more handshake refactoring
Matthias Schiffer
2013-10-31
Rename session_init to session_init_compat to prepare for the upcoming new ke...
Matthias Schiffer
[next]